Homeless Christmas Lunch
On Monday 19thDecember South Lakes Foyer organised and hosted a 4 course Christmas Lunch for local homeless people.
People involved in local homeless schemes and projects were invited to have a 4 course Christmas Lunch prepared by Mr and Mrs Capstick, who have recently taken over the café at South Lakes Foyer. Staff from the Foyer and Miller Court helped to serve the traditional Christmas meal, which received high praise from all 30 people who attended. The meal was followed by a film chosen by everyone, so the afternoon was an enjoyable viewing of recently remade A-Team.

Volunteer Fayre
On Tuesday 10thJanuary 2012 we held our first Volunteers Fayre at South Lakes Foyer. We had a wide range of voluntary organisations exhibiting including MIND, Guiding Association, St John’s Hospice and Barnardo’s. We were able to arrange local radio advertising which resulted in the event being well attended by people from the South Lakes region. Each exhibitor made contact with potential volunteers and some of the Young People from the foyer were able to access local organisation to discuss volunteer opportunities.
